    About

    Develop your understanding of human nature and communication

    Media and Communication is the cornerstone to psychology. Studying the combined Bachelor of Psychological Science/Bachelor of Media and Communication will prepare you with foundational knowledge in both areas and provide you with a broad skillset to be used in a variety of fields.

    With a range of course options, you’ll learn to push your individual creative boundaries, while examining the changing nature of today’s complex social landscapes.

    This program is for those who are interested in using science to understand people while also learning how to effectively communicate information across multiple mediums.

    Career

    This combined program can be applied in a broad range of industry sectors, enabling you to choose the career path that’s right for you. You might work in media and communications, for a multi-national business or with the law, police, or correctional services.

    Careers opportunities may include:

  • Case Worker
  • Careers Counsellor
  • Foreign Correspondent
  • Feature Writer
  • Film/Television Production
  • Behavioural Interventionalist
  • Victims Advocate
  • Project and Research Manager
  • Public Relations Manager
  • Strategic Planner
  • A registered psychologist role (including clinical psychologist) requires additional study (an Honours plus relevant Masters degree).
